About Sandringham 3191

The size of Sandringham is approximately 3.7 square kilometres. It has 17 parks covering nearly 17.5% of total area. The population of Sandringham in 2016 was 10241 people. By 2021 the population was 10926 showing a population growth of 6.7%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Sandringham is 50-59 years. Households in Sandringham are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Sandringham work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 71.90% of the homes in Sandringham were owner-occupied compared with 71.00% in 2016.

Sandringham has 6,542 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Sandringham have seen a 10.47%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 15.40% increase. As at 28 February 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Sandringham is $2,248,857 while the median value for Units is $859,046.
  • Houses have a median rent of $995 while Units have a median rent of $590.
